java如何在屏幕上输入数据

java如何在屏幕上输入数据

作者:Elara发布时间:2026-02-27阅读时长:0 分钟阅读次数:9

用户关注问题

Q
怎样使用Java读取用户在控制台输入的数据?

我想用Java程序从键盘获取用户输入的信息,该怎么实现?

A

使用Scanner类从控制台获取输入

可以通过导入java.util.Scanner类来实现从控制台读取用户输入。创建Scanner对象并调用其方法如nextLine()、nextInt()等即可获取对应类型的数据。

Q
Java中如何捕获用户输入的不同数据类型?

如果我需要用户输入数字、字符串或者浮点数,Java中怎么区分并读取?

A

利用Scanner的多种读取方法

Scanner类提供nextInt()、nextDouble()、nextLine()等方法,用来读取不同类型的输入。应根据需要调用相应的方法来获取准确的数据类型。

Q
有没有简单的Java代码示例,演示如何从屏幕输入数据?

我想看看一个基础的Java程序,从屏幕接收输入并打印出来,能提供示例代码吗?

A

基础示例:使用Scanner读取并打印输入

示例代码:
import java.util.Scanner;

public class InputExample {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.println("请输入内容:");
String input = scanner.nextLine();
System.out.println("您输入的是:" + input);
scanner.close();
}
}